To find the RSS feed's URL simply look for the RSS button on the website's homepage (usually an orange button) and click on it, then copy and paste the URL into your News Reader. However, certain News Readers will ask for the URL of the website's RSS feed. Many News Readers will allow you to simply enter the main URL of the website. There will be a box for you to input a URL. Inside your reader you will see a button that says 'subscribe,' 'add feed' or something similar. If you do not have an RSS Reader you will need to download one.
